Responsible gambling tools help players maintain control over their betting behavior. Setting deposit limits is a practical first step, allowing users to cap daily, weekly, or monthly spending. Many platforms also offer reality checks—pop-up reminders of time spent playing—along with self-exclusion options for those needing a longer break. Key strategies include:
- Only gamble with money you can afford to lose
- Never chase losses by increasing bets
- Balance gambling with other leisure activities
Combining these tools with mindful habits reduces financial and emotional risk. Reviewing account statements regularly helps detect patterns early, ensuring gambling remains an occasional form of entertainment rather than a problem. Most licensed sites provide these features under their “safer gambling” section.

When comparing VIP and High Roller programs, the fundamental distinction lies in entry requirements and reward structures. High Roller programs are typically transactional, offering immediate cashback, faster payouts, and higher betting limits to players who stake large sums over a short period. In contrast, VIP programs focus on long-term loyalty, providing curated experiences like luxury travel, dedicated account managers, and exclusive event access. Choose your program based on actual wagering volume and preferred reward type. While High Rollers benefit from instant financial incentives, VIPs gain personalized service and intangible perks. Most importantly, always verify the terms for wagering requirements and withdrawal conditions, as high-limit play can trigger stricter compliance checks.

Regional Payment Preferences
Understanding regional payment preferences is critical for global e-commerce success. In North America, credit and debit cards dominate, with digital wallets like PayPal and Apple Pay growing rapidly. European markets, however, often favor bank transfers (e.g., SEPA) and local schemes like iDEAL in the Netherlands or Sofort in Germany. Asia presents a starkly fragmented landscape: China is almost entirely cashless via Alipay and WeChat Pay, while Japan still relies heavily on cash and konbini payments. Latin America sees strong adoption of alternative methods like Brazil’s PIX and Mexico’s OXXO, driven by lower banking penetration. Ignoring these nuances leads to cart abandonment; your checkout must localize options by region to build trust and maximize conversion. Always prioritize offering the top three methods for each target market.
